feat(channels): add Pushover notification channel and tool

Add Pushover as an outbound notification channel with a corresponding
pushover tool that the agent can use to send push notifications.

- Add PushoverConfig to config with app_token and user_key fields
- Add PushoverChannel implementation with message truncation (1024 char limit)
- Add PushoverTool for agent-initiated notifications
- Register Pushover channel in manager and tool in agent loop
- Add SKILL.md documentation and config example

pkg/channels/pushover.go Normal file
View file

@ -0,0 +1,89 @@
package channels
import (
"context"
"fmt"
"net/http"
"net/url"
"strings"
"github.com/sipeed/picoclaw/pkg/bus"
"github.com/sipeed/picoclaw/pkg/config"
"github.com/sipeed/picoclaw/pkg/logger"
)
type PushoverChannel struct {
*BaseChannel
config config.PushoverConfig
client *http.Client
}
func NewPushoverChannel(cfg config.PushoverConfig, bus *bus.MessageBus) (*PushoverChannel, error) {
base := NewBaseChannel("pushover", cfg, bus, nil)
return &PushoverChannel{
BaseChannel: base,
config: cfg,
client: &http.Client{},
}, nil
}
func (c *PushoverChannel) Name() string {
return "pushover"
}
func (c *PushoverChannel) Start(ctx context.Context) error {
logger.InfoC("pushover", "Starting Pushover channel")
c.setRunning(true)
return nil
}
func (c *PushoverChannel) Stop(ctx context.Context) error {
logger.InfoC("pushover", "Stopping Pushover channel")
c.setRunning(false)
return nil
}
func (c *PushoverChannel) Send(ctx context.Context, msg bus.OutboundMessage) error {
if !c.IsRunning() {
return fmt.Errorf("pushover channel not running")
}
if c.config.AppToken == "" || c.config.UserKey == "" {
return fmt.Errorf("pushover app_token and user_key are required")
}
data := url.Values{}
data.Set("token", c.config.AppToken)
data.Set("user", c.config.UserKey)
// Truncate message if too long (Pushover limit is 1024 chars)
message := msg.Content
if len(message) > 1024 {
message = message[:1021] + "..."
}
data.Set("message", message)
req, err := http.NewRequestWithContext(ctx, "POST", "https://api.pushover.net/1/messages.json", strings.NewReader(data.Encode()))
if err != nil {
return fmt.Errorf("failed to create request: %w", err)
}
req.Header.Set("Content-Type", "application/x-www-form-urlencoded")
resp, err := c.client.Do(req)
if err != nil {
return fmt.Errorf("failed to send notification: %w", err)
}
defer resp.Body.Close()
if resp.StatusCode != 200 {
return fmt.Errorf("pushover API returned status %d", resp.StatusCode)
}
logger.DebugCF("pushover", "Notification sent", map[string]any{
"content_length": len(msg.Content),
})
return nil
}

pkg/tools/pushover.go Normal file
View file

@ -0,0 +1,61 @@
package tools
import (
"context"
"fmt"
)
type PushoverTool struct {
pushoverCallback func(message string) error
}
func NewPushoverTool() *PushoverTool {
return &PushoverTool{}
}
func (t *PushoverTool) Name() string {
return "pushover"
}
func (t *PushoverTool) Description() string {
return "Send a push notification to your phone via Pushover. Use this when you need to notify yourself of something important."
}
func (t *PushoverTool) Parameters() map[string]interface{} {
return map[string]interface{}{
"type": "object",
"properties": map[string]interface{}{
"message": map[string]interface{}{
"type": "string",
"description": "The notification message to send to your phone",
},
},
"required": []string{"message"},
}
}
func (t *PushoverTool) SetPushoverCallback(callback func(message string) error) {
t.pushoverCallback = callback
}
func (t *PushoverTool) Execute(ctx context.Context, args map[string]interface{}) *ToolResult {
message, ok := args["message"].(string)
if !ok {
return &ToolResult{ForLLM: "message is required", IsError: true}
}
if t.pushoverCallback == nil {
return &ToolResult{ForLLM: "Pushover not configured", IsError: true}
}
if err := t.pushoverCallback(message); err != nil {
return &ToolResult{
ForLLM: fmt.Sprintf("failed to send pushover notification: %v", err),
IsError: true,
}
}
return &ToolResult{
ForLLM: fmt.Sprintf("Push notification sent: %s", message),
}
}

# Pushover
Pushover is a notification service. Use the pushover tool to send push notifications to your devices.
## Configuration
```json
{
"channels": {
"pushover": {
"enabled": true,
"app_token": "your-app-token",
"user_key": "your-user-key"
}
}
}
```
